Introduction

The PRIMERGY TX300 S3 server is an Intel-based server for mid-size and
large companies. The server is suitable for use as a file server and also as an
application, information or Internet server. It is available as a floorstand or rack
model. The floorstand model can be converted to a rack model using an optional
conversion kit.
Thanks to its highly developed hardware and software components, the
PRIMERGY TX300 S3 server offers a high level of data security and availability.
These components include hot-plug hard disk drive modules and power supply
units, redundant system fans and hot-plug PCI slots, the Server Management
ServerView Suite, Prefailure Detection and Analysing (PDA) and Automatic
Server Reconfiguration and Restart (ASR&R).
Security functions in the BIOS Setup and on the system board protect the data
on the server against manipulation. Additional security is provided by the
intrusion detection and the lockable drive cover on the floorstand model and the
lockable rack door on the rack model.
The rack model occupies 4 height units in the rack.

Documentation Overview

I
PRIMERGY manuals are available in PDF format on the ServerBooks
DVD. The ServerBooks DVD is part of the ServerStart Suite supplied with
every server system.
The PDF files for the manuals can also be downloaded free of charge
from the Internet. The overview page showing the online documentation
available in the Internet can be found via the URL: http://manuals.fujitsu-
siemens.com (click industry standard servers).
